To colonize a planet, an empire needs first to own the system via a Starbase and to send a colony ship to the planet. To colonize a planet, select the colonization ship, right click on the planet you want to settle, and choose Colonize Planet.

How does colonization work in Star Trek stellaris?
This article has been verified for the current PC version (2.6) of the game. Colonization is the process of moving Pops via a Colony Ship to a previously uninhabited but habitable planet. The first time an empire colonizes another world it will gain between 60 and 150 Engineering Research.
Can you build a meteorite colony ship in stellaris?
Empires with the Calamitous Birth Origin can build Meteorite Colony Ships. Meteorite Colony ships are built twice as fast as regular Colony Ships and cost only 500 Minerals. When they are used to colonize the world gains a Lithoid Crater modifier and a Buried Lithoids blocker. Your new planet will take time to settle.
